Revealed: The Diary of a CEO's United wish-list
Manchester United fan Steven Bartlett has set his sights on interviewing Harry Maguire and three other Old Trafford figures for his popular podcast series, The Diary of a CEO.
During an interview with MUTV, the entrepreneur began by describing his away-end experience on Merseyside and revealed the celebratory message he sent to match-winner Maguire.
“It was unbelievable, unbelievable,” said Steven.
“I mean, there was so much surrounding it that kinds of feeds into the context. I had actually interviewed Jurgen Klopp that week and we talked about the club and everything, and the interview was coming out the next day.
“So the rivalry, the derby, the history of it and the 7-0 was all very front of mind for me. But just the way that it played out couldn't have been better.
“We can all think of history at Anfield when, once they get one back, the game is over because they get another one and they do what Liverpool are known for doing at Anfield. It was a really, really important and symbolic thing that we fought back at Anfield to win.
“I was so chuffed for Harry and I actually texted him after, calling him Sir Clutch Maguire. He deserves it, I think.”
“I am hoping to interview Ruben Amorim if he is around here somewhere, Sir Jim [Ratcliffe] as well. I saw he just walked past me so hopefully I am going to interview Sir Jim at some point... if you guys can help make that happen, I would appreciate it!
“Who would you like to see me interview? One United player... I think fans might say Harry because he's had an unbelievable arc over the last couple of years. I think they would either say Maguire or maybe Bruno [Fernandes] because he is captain and he tends to speak his mind.”
